    1920 Federal Census, Cherokee County, South Carolina, 22 January, Cherokee Township, District 3, page 15B, Hse #240, Fam #242
    McSwain, Lewis H Head Rents M W 43 SC NC NC Farmer [b abt 1876]
    McSwain, Aider Wife F W 35 NC NC SC [b abt 1884]
    McSwain, Mildred Dau F W 16 SC SC NC [b abt 1903]
    McSwain, Lammar Son M W 13 SC SC NC Machinist [b abt 1906]
    McSwain, Audery Dau F W 11 SC SC NC [b abt 1908]
    McSwain, Margret Dau F W 9 SC SC NC [b abt 1910]
    McSwain, William Son M W 7 SC SC NC [b abt 1912]
    McSwain, Aider L Dau F  W 4yrs4mos SC SC NC [b abt 1915]
    McSwain, Jason D Son M W 2yrs2mos SC SC NC [b abt 1917]
    Hardin, Alexander P Cousin M W 58 SC SC SC [b abt 1861]
    Hardin, Margret Mother-in-Law M W 67 SC SC SC [b abt 1852]

    Fulton was Ada's maiden name, and Hardin her mother's maiden name.  Margaret oddly appears here with her maiden name Hardin.  The Alexander P Hardin here is Ada's cousin, being the son of John Logan Hardin, according to the Hardin family genealogy.  John Logan Hardin was Margaret's brother, thus Alexander is Margaret's nephew.  Margaret and John's father was Elisha Hardin, their mother Sarah Whisnant or Whisonant.  In 1910, we found that Margaret's last name there is her married name Fulton.  I wonder why she took back her maiden name after 1910.  I have found no clue to this in the Hardin genealogy.

    1930 Federal Census, Cherokee County, South Carolina, 4 April, Cherokee Township, District 35, page 3A-B, Hse/Fam #45
    McSwain, Lewis H Head Owns M W  52 Married at age 26 SC SC SC Farmer [b abt 1878]
    -- page 3B --
    McSwain, Ada F Wife F W  45 Married at age 18 SC NC SC [b abt 1885]
    McSwain, Ordrey A Dau F W 21 Single SC SC SC [b abt March 1909]
    McSwain, William  M W 18 Single NC SC SC SC  Farm Laborer [b abt March 1912]
    McSwain, Ada L Dau F W 14 Single SC SC SC [b abt March 1916]
    McSwain, Jason D  M W 12 Single SC SC SC [b abt March 1918]

    Ada's middle initial F here seems to stand for her maiden name Fulton.  Fulton and Hardin famliy genealogies give her name as Sarah Ada Fulton.
